Cost of Yard Flattening in Bellingham
Yard flattening is a common landscaping project in Bellingham, WA, aimed at creating a more usable and aesthetically pleasing outdoor space. Whether you're looking to install a new lawn, build a patio, or simply improve drainage, understanding the costs involved is crucial for proper budgeting.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Yard: Larger yards require more labor and materials, increasing the overall cost.
- Slope and Terrain: Steeper slopes and uneven terrain can complicate the flattening process, leading to higher expenses.
- Soil Type: Rocky or clay-heavy soil can be more difficult to work with, requiring specialized equipment and techniques.
- Accessibility: Yards that are difficult to access may require additional machinery or labor, adding to the cost.
- Permits and Regulations: Local regulations and necessary permits can vary, impacting the total expenditure.
- Additional Features: Incorporating elements like retaining walls, drainage systems, or irrigation can significantly affect the final price.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
| Task | Average Cost in Bellingham, WA | 
|---|---|
| Basic Yard Flattening | $1,500 - $3,000 | 
| Installing Retaining Wall | $2,000 - $5,000 | 
| Soil Testing and Treatment | $200 - $500 | 
| Drainage System Installation | $1,000 - $3,000 | 
| Sod Installation | $1,000 - $2,500 | 
| Grading and Leveling | $1,200 - $2,800 |
